ClearSign: An AI Contract Risk Check for Freelancers

ClearSign is a smart tool built to help freelancers understand contract terms before they sign them. Many people sign agreements without reading them carefully, hoping the other side will be fair. ClearSign uses artificial intelligence to read the document and explain the risks in simple English. It is designed to protect freelancers from hidden dangers that could cost them money or their work.

Benefits

ClearSign offers several important advantages for anyone working as a freelancer.

  • Simple Explanations: The tool breaks down complex legal language into plain English that anyone can understand.
  • Risk Categorization: It sorts every clause into three levels of danger: High, Medium, or Low. This helps users prioritize which parts of the contract need attention.
  • Specific Warnings: Instead of giving a vague warning, ClearSign points to the exact sentence that causes the problem.
  • Real Consequences: It explains what happens if a bad clause is signed, such as losing the right to get paid or giving away all your ideas.
  • Affordable Cost: It is much cheaper than hiring a lawyer to review a single document.

Use Cases

This tool is perfect for freelancers who need to review contracts quickly and safely.

  • Reviewing Client Proposals: When a client sends a contract, a freelancer can upload the file to check for unfair terms before agreeing to the work.
  • Checking Own Templates: Freelancers can use it to find missing protections in their own standard contracts, such as clauses that limit revisions or claim ownership of the work.
  • Negotiation Prep: Users can identify risky parts of a deal so they know what to ask for during the discussion.
  • One-Time Checks: The pay-per-review option allows users to check a single document for a small fee without committing to a monthly plan.
